There’s been a number of Earthquakes have been hitting Caribbean islands over the past few days. The latest was a magnitude 3.7 earthquake was reported northeast of Dominica last evening.
According to reports from the UWI Seismic Research Center (UWI SRC), the quake occurred around 7:07 pm at a depth of 91 km.
the Automatic Earthquake Location from the UWI Seismic Research Center said that the quake struck:
- Roseau, Dominica, 44 km, NE
- Point-à-Pitre, Guadeloupe, 90 km, SE
- Fort-de-France, Martinique, 107 km, N
